Robin House Children’s Hospice bags £2,000 donation from Scotmid

Scotmid customers in West Dunbartonshire have raised £2,000 for Robin House Children’s Hospice in Alexandria through the sale of carrier bags in local stores. Grace Wilson from the Children’s Hospice Association of Scotland (CHAS) visited Scotmid’s Alexandria store today to accept a cheque from staff. Crowds ‘Boogie’ on down to meet radio star at new-look Scotmid

Boogie from 97.3 Forth One officially opened the new-look Scotmid store on St John’s Road in Corstorphine today (Friday 23 August 2013). Pilrig takes a fresh look at new Scotmid store

Scotmid’s store in Pilrig re-launched today (16 August 2013) with a brand new look and a range of new in-store services for customers.
